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52607780 4636097 20562670845
050560924 326596
050560924 326596
62124 241671 73766790900
All about undefined
Interested in learning more?
050560924 326596
62124 241671 73766790900
See more
2164 9309420
72949658 7160507 6651 54447
See more
65246924 728 86505130473
77343 57539200 64701 57 45780
See more